logo

Output 43e895dea6871ae8ba492837aae5b355e9d9141e437d51cf319b9b83bf2be9a4:4

value
418490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870b68694735a4e5e602b4e78af86590c998e91d OP_EQUAL
address
3E14p5AYiAns38FT1bpanfspggJEmjmRu3
transaction
43e895dea6871ae8ba492837aae5b355e9d9141e437d51cf319b9b83bf2be9a4